This paper analyzes the university experience that favored dropout and the paths taken by young people in graduate courses at Universidade de São Paulo (USP), offered in the city of São Paulo during the period 2002-2016. This is a longitudinal research with quantitative analysis of dropout and interviews conducted in depth with a sample of twenty-two USP deserting students and graduates. From the interviews, the authors delineate four trajectory profiles, according to time spent and course completion status. They conclude that the trajectories and experiences pointed out that the dropout rate depends on differences in the links established with the university, as well as by the conditions and lifestyles of the young people. In contrast, class determinations do not make explicit the incidences of dropout at USP.
